NFL Announces New 'Rivalries' Jerseys to Debut in 2025 with AFC East, NFC West Teams
The NFL and Nike announced its "Rivalries" jersey program on Friday, according to Jonathan Jones of CBS Sports, with AFC East and NFC West teams getting new uniforms in 2025 "that will be inspired by the local communities of the NFL teams."
Jones added that "teams can choose to wear the jersey each year against the same divisional rival or across the division. And because the jerseys must be worn in home games, there wouldn't be a game featuring both teams wearing the jerseys."

The new Rivalries uniforms won't replace the current alternate and throwback options for teams and will be in a team's rotation for three years.
"The NFL is home to some of the biggest rivalries in football," the NFL's EVP and chief revenue officer, Renie Anderson, told Jones. "We decided to team up with Nike to allow fans and players to connect like never before with the Rivalries program because nothing brings communities together quite like a good rivalry. We know our fans and players are excited for games with their club's biggest rivals and wanted to make these even bigger. And we know our fans (especially our younger fans) and players get excited when their clubs wear unique and or special uniforms."
Jones noted that new uniforms for the participating teams in 2025 are expected to be unveiled sometime this summer.
